However, a premium QLED TV might not be for everyone. If you primarily watch standard-definition content, rarely stream, or are not concerned with color accuracy and deep contrast, a more basic LED TV might suffice and save you money. Similarly, if your viewing environment is extremely bright with direct sunlight and you cannot control ambient light, or if you consistently watch from very wide angles, some QLED panels, while excellent, may still exhibit some wash-out compared to an OLED. In such cases, an OLED TV might offer superior off-angle viewing and true blacks, albeit often at a higher price point. Before buying, consider your primary use (movies, gaming, casual viewing), your viewing environment (room brightness, viewing angles), and your budget. Also, think about connectivity needs (how many HDMI ports, USB ports) and desired smart features (voice assistants, app availability).

QLED Display Technology and 4K Resolution

The heart of this television’s visual prowess lies in its QLED display technology. Unlike traditional LED TVs, QLED screens utilize Quantum Dots – microscopic nanocrystals that emit incredibly precise and pure colors. This translates to an expansive color volume, meaning the TV can display over a billion shades with remarkable accuracy, even in the brightest scenes. Quantum HDR and Superior Contrast

The Samsung Q7F Series excels in delivering exceptional contrast through its Quantum HDR capabilities, specifically supporting HDR10+. This feature is about more than just brighter whites; it’s about revealing hidden details in both the darkest shadows and the most dazzling highlights. The dynamic tone mapping of HDR10+ enhances contrast on a scene-by-scene basis, ensuring that deep blacks are truly deep and vibrant brights truly shine. Gaming Hub and Performance

For gamers, the Samsung 50-Inch QLED Q7F is a fantastic choice, especially given its price point. The dedicated Gaming Hub provides a centralized platform for all your gaming needs, making it easy to jump into your favorite titles. The TV’s Game Mode automatically optimizes settings for a responsive and fluid gaming experience, minimizing input lag. While its 60Hz refresh rate is standard for many modern games, the Motion Xcelerator technology ensures smoother on-screen motion, reducing blur and judder during fast-paced action. I primarily run a PS5 through this TV, and with a few minor adjustments (like turning off picture clarity or setting judder to 0, and HDR tone mapping to static), the gaming performance is superb. Connectivity and Integration

The Samsung 50-Inch Q7F offers a comprehensive suite of connectivity options: Bluetooth, Wi-Fi, USB, Ethernet, and three HDMI ports. The inclusion of HDMI ARC (Audio Return Channel) is particularly useful, allowing for seamless integration with soundbars and AV receivers with zero delay or lag, as I experienced first-hand. This array of ports and wireless technologies ensures that all your external devices, from gaming consoles and Blu-ray players to streaming sticks and sound systems, can be easily connected and managed. The Bluetooth connectivity is especially handy for pairing wireless headphones or connecting soundbars without needing an optical cable, a design choice by Samsung that streamlines setups.
